Guesswork, Large Deviations, and Shannon Entropy [PDF]

open access: yesIEEE Transactions on Information Theory, 2013
How hard is it guess a password? Massey showed that that the Shannon entropy of the distribution from which the password is selected is a lower bound on the expected number of guesses, but one which is not tight in general. Quantifying Daseinisation Using Shannon Entropy

open access: yesWSEAS TRANSACTIONS ON SYSTEMS, 2020
Topos formalism for quantum mechanics is interpreted in a broader, information retrieval, perspective. Contexts, its basic components, are treated as sources of information. Their interplay, called daseinisation, defined in purely logical terms, is reformulated in terms of two relations: exclusion and preclusion of queries.

Constraints of Compound Systems: Prerequisites for Thermodynamic Modeling Based on Shannon Entropy

open access: yesEntropy, 2014
Thermodynamic modeling of extensive systems usually implicitly assumes the additivity of entropy. Furthermore, if this modeling is based on the concept of Shannon entropy, additivity of the latter function must also be guaranteed.
